Elbe River Dredging Kicks Off

The job to expand as well as strengthen the Elbe River has actually started with the arrival of DEME Group’s receptacle dredger ‘Scheldt River’.

The job contains expanding as well as strengthening the 72-mile lengthy Elbe fairway, causing the port of Hamburg, to permit two-way website traffic of ultra-large containerships without constraints.

“This is very good news for our trading and shipping customers in the German and European hinterland and all our worldwide business partners,” stated Axel Mattern, Joint CHIEF EXECUTIVE OFFICER of Port of Hamburg Marketing.

Following conclusion of the job, ocean-going ships will certainly be allowed to leave Hamburg with a draft of 13.5 meters, or 14.5 meters relying on trend, which is a whole meter greater than presently permitted. The Port of Hamburg approximates the added draft will certainly permit containerships to deliver around 1,800 even more twenty-foot containers per telephone call.

Belgium- based DEME Group was granted EUR 238 million strengthening agreement back inApril The job will certainly include the dredging, transport as well as moving of about 32 million cubic meters of product from the riverbed.

The Port of Hamburg is the third-busiest container port in Europe, dealing with around 8.7 million TEU in 2018 as well as about 8,000 vessel calls annually.
